To ensure the normal and safe operation of low-voltage switchgear cabinets, the location of the low-voltage switchgear room should be close to the load center. The installation site must be free from dust, corrosive substances, and other contaminants; otherwise, these should be promptly removed. For safety reasons, the environment should be relatively dry and well-ventilated, and the installation site should ideally be free from vibrations.
 
The arrangement of distribution equipment in low-voltage switchgear cabinets must be carried out under the premises of safety, reliability, suitability, and economy. Additionally, the layout should facilitate installation, operation, handling, maintenance, testing, and monitoring. Between high- and low-voltage electrical equipment located within the same room, as well as between rows of arranged switchgear cabinets, adequate spacing and accessible passageways must be provided. When arranging distribution equipment, necessary safety measures shall be adopted; for instance, exposed live parts with hazardous potentials must be shielded or positioned beyond the reach of human arms. When it is difficult to use shields or enclosures, barriers may be employed for protection.
 
The arrangement of distribution circuits in low-voltage switchgear shall meet the following conditions: it must conform to the environmental characteristics of the installation location; it must be consistent with the architectural features of the building; it must ensure that the distance between people and the conductors is appropriate; it must take into account the electromechanical stresses that may arise from short circuits; and it must consider other stresses that the wiring may experience during installation and operation, as well as the weight of the conductors themselves.
 
What factors affect the arrangement of distribution lines in low-voltage switchgear? These include preventing external heat from impacting operation, avoiding water ingress that could impair performance, guarding against external mechanical damage that might affect functionality, keeping dust from accumulating on wiring to ensure proper operation, and protecting against the effects of strong radiation.
 
Precautions for Low-Voltage Distribution Cabinets
 
1: During maintenance, a dedicated person must be assigned to provide supervision.
 
2: You must check for voltage before starting work.
 
3: Maintenance personnel should be familiar with and able to operate the electrical and mechanical interlocking system of the entire distribution cabinet.
 
4: During maintenance, you should carefully identify which lines are supplied by dual circuits.
 
5: When inspecting the busbar, thoroughly discharge any residual charges remaining in the circuit.
